Excellent points, Arcadian! :clap: I'm pretty sure I have the finger real estate for this; I have approx 20mm east to west when my fingers are closed/against each other (which I rarely keep them). The center is 6.2mm wide (if set north/south), plus 5mm each trillion. Lets call that 18mm including an air line on each side of the spinel.

Also, I think it will have enough light. The center would set up a smidge above the sapphires, allowing light in from the sides, and I would think the white sapphires might also allow more light or reflect it some into the center as well. And it is open on the north &a south sides just beaneath the semi-bezels. Here is the setting 'as is' from the side and underneath.
